STEP-BY-STEP GUIDE

How to get your Instagram data.

Instagram lets you export your followers and following list directly. Pick the method that works for you.

Only request Followers and Following, not your entire Instagram history. A focused export is ready in under 2 minutes.

1

Go to Instagram Accounts Center

You can do this on any device - phone, tablet, or desktop browser. The quickest way is to go directly to accountscenter.instagram.com. Or navigate there manually: open Instagram, go to your Profile, then Settings and privacy, then Accounts Center.

2

Open Your Information and Permissions

Inside Accounts Center, tap or click Your information and permissions.

3

Go to Export Your Information

Tap Export your information. You'll see two options. Choose Export to device (not "Transfer to destination").

4

Select only Followers and Following

Tap Create export. Select your Instagram account, choose "Download to device", then under Customize information deselect everything and check only Followers and Following. When asked for a date range, select All time - any shorter range will only export recent followers, not your full list.

5

Choose JSON format, then tap "Start export"

Instagram will ask for a format. Choose JSON, not HTML. JSON includes timestamps and our parser handles it fully.

Then tap Start export. Instagram will process your request in the background.

6

Download the ZIP from your email

Within a few minutes, Instagram sends an email with a download link. Tap the link and download the ZIP to your device.

The download link expires in 4 days. Download the ZIP as soon as you get the email.

TIMING

How long does the export take?

Most exports arrive within 1–5 minutes. If yours has not appeared after 15 minutes, here is what to check:

·Check your spam or promotions folder. Instagram sends from security-noreply@instagram.com
·Make sure you selected JSON format, not HTML - HTML exports sometimes take longer
·Instagram throttles export requests. If you requested recently, wait 14 days before trying again
·On rare occasions Instagram can take up to 48 hours, especially during high-traffic periods

The download link in the email expires in 4 days. Download the ZIP as soon as it arrives.

FILE STRUCTURE

What's actually inside the file you download?

FOLDER STRUCTURE
instagram-username-20260428.zip
└── followers_and_following/
    ├── followers_1.json      ← everyone who follows you
    └── following.json        ← everyone you follow

WHAT THE JSON LOOKS LIKE
[
  {
    "string_list_data": [{
      "value": "username",
      "timestamp": 1714512000
    }]
  }
]

This is what our parser reads. The timestamp tells you exactly when someone followed you.

TROUBLESHOOTING

Common problems and how to fix them.

I didn't receive the Instagram export email

Check your spam folder first. The sender is security-noreply@instagram.com. If it's not there after 15 minutes, go back to Accounts Center and confirm your request was submitted. Try requesting again - sometimes the first request silently fails.

The download link in the email has expired

Export links expire after 4 days. Go back to Accounts Center and request a new export. You'll get a fresh link within minutes.

My export only shows recent followers, not my full list

You selected the wrong date range. Go back and request again - under "Date range" select All time, not Last month or Last year. Any shorter range gives you a partial list.

Instagram is asking me to export my full archive

You navigated to the wrong option. Make sure you choose "Export to device" (not "Transfer to destination") and then under Customize information, deselect everything except Followers and Following.

The ZIP file won't open or shows an error on WhoUnfollowed

Make sure you're uploading the original ZIP Instagram sent - don't unzip and re-zip it, and don't rename the file. If you're on iOS, make sure you downloaded it with the Files app, not the Mail app.

FAQ

Frequently asked questions.

Does requesting an Instagram data export notify my followers?
No. The export is completely private. Your followers have no way of knowing you requested or downloaded your data.
How often can I request an Instagram data export?
Instagram allows one export request approximately every 14 days per account.
Is it safe to request my Instagram data export?
Yes. It is an official Instagram feature required under GDPR. No third-party app is involved at any point.
What format should I choose - JSON or HTML?
Always choose JSON. It includes timestamps showing when each person followed you, and it's the format our parser is built for. HTML is only for human reading and contains less data.
Can I request an Instagram data export on desktop?
Yes. Go to accountscenter.instagram.com → Your information and permissions → Export your information. The process is identical to mobile.
Why do I only need the Followers and Following export, not my full archive?
The full Instagram archive can be several gigabytes and takes much longer. Followers and Following is a small, focused export - usually under 1MB - and ready in minutes.
